Leopold Vícha is a human[1]. He was born in Žimrovice[2]. He was born on +1846-11-11T00:00:00Z[3]. He passed away in Frenštát pod Radhoštěm[4]. He died on +1921-11-21T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as a teacher[6], folklorist[7], composer[8], opinion journalist[9], and musician[10].
